
About this Dog
Lynn, Lynne, or Lynnie is a lovely, beautiful little girl. She is about a year old and weighs 27 pounds. She has the face and voice of a beagle (she sometimes bays but other than if she's startled by something, she doesn't bark much). She's shaped like a dachshund - as "they" say, a dog and a half long and half a dog tall. Lynnie is very affectionate and loves being right next to her person or on their lap. She is housebroken and after a few minutes she settles down and is quiet in her crate. She's is in her crate when no one is home and for meals but sleeps in bed with the other dogs and me overnight. Someone is home most of the time here and the dogs go out quite a few times during the day and evening. She's very curious about what's going on in and outside the yard when we are outside. She loves to run and play in the yard but can also be lazy in the house. She particularly loves chewing on nylabones. Lynnie is quiet in the car, traveling in a crate, but hasn't yet been for a ride with a doggie seatbelt. Lynnie has been for several walks on a harness but does pull so she needs continued work with that. Lynnie is very good with the other dogs in the pack but she is not good with cats and maybe not with other small animals either. She hasn't been around children since she's been with us. She might prefer women as she seems anxious around men. Adoption fee includes: Full veterinary exam, Alter, Prepaid microchip, Dewormed, Rabies vaccine (if age appropriate), Distemper combo vaccine(s) appropriate to age, Bordetella vaccine, 4DX (over 6 months of age), Flea/tick and heartworm preventative while in rescue.
